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31 092814 61 401781
3305 31239392486
3305 31239392486
8696829218 14633 85551924
All about undefined
Interested in learning more?
3305 31239392486
8696829218 14633 85551924
See more
2923984764 4344072233 915
632751414 50078 232596512 7369
See more
63024173 91226088 9421
307025419 29848 53488 46733
See more